单片机c语言是怎么写彩屏,51单片机驱动2.4寸彩屏赏玩记

本文记录了使用51单片机驱动2.4寸彩屏的过程,从转接ISP编程器、编写与下载程序到成功显示图片和汉字,探讨了C语言在单片机编程中的应用,以及在实践中的技术挑战和解决方案。
摘要由CSDN通过智能技术生成

前几天在网上找到一款2.4吋屏,买来几天一直没空玩,这几天放假,正在玩玩。这个屏价格不高,显示效果却非常好,分辨率为240×320的,显示非常细腻,买的时候看网上那个图片不太好,但反正不贵,所以抱着无所谓的态度买来玩玩。拿到手后看到的结果却远比当时的图片要好,全新的屏非常漂亮,光看外观就觉得值了。

拿到手的是一个套件,就是作者开源的数码相框作品。拿到手的板比较粗糙,包括板上用于编程的编程插座都没有安装。因为是贴片的ATMEGA88,估计没装插座的话也没有写过代码。按作者提示找了个二节电池座,接上电,果然什么也没有显示出来。因此,要玩第一步就要将代码写进去。我手边有西尔特的SUPRO U280编程器,但对于焊在板上的贴片无能为力。所以只能找ISP编程器了,由于这个玩艺是3V电池供电,所以要用它能ISP编程器供电可能够呛,这样只能用USB型的ISPRO了。找来USB型ISPRO,它是十脚接口中,板上是6针,不能匹配,于是又找来一个双排十针座和单排针,单排孔,将单排针焊到板子上,单排孔与双排十针座用线连接,做个转接器。这里要注意板上的针是6针单排,所以一不小心有可能会插反,那可能会烧毁的,怎么办呢?从原来买的周立功的那个ISP座得到启发,6针中第一针是VCC,在USB型的编程器上用不到,仍装6针,但是将第一针(VCC)剪掉,而孔仍装6个,但是将第一个孔用一段线给塞上。这样,只要保证不错位插入,就可以保证不会插反了(插反了插不进去)。一阵忙活,一个下午完了。

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值